About River’s Bend Trout–Sebec

Our Mission

TF-EMDR therapist giving fly fishing instruction.
River’s Bend Trout–Sebec provides therapeutic outdoor programs tailored to the unique needs of veterans, active-duty military, first responders, educators, caregivers, and their families through transformative outdoor experiences that promote self-empowerment, healing, resilience, and connection.
Through the art of fly fishing, participants can heal in a peaceful, supportive environment. Our programs focus on emotional recovery and stress relief, promoting healing through nature’s calming presence. By offering an inclusive space, we aim to guide individuals on their journey to better mental well-being, using the transformative power of the great outdoors. We provide inclusive, adaptive adventures that support physical and emotional well-being, strengthen family bonds, and honor the service and sacrifices of our nation’s heroes.

Our Story

Our mission was born out of a deep commitment to serving those who have selflessly served others. Founded in Sebec, Maine, River’s Bend Trout–Sebec (RBT-S) is a registered 501(c)(3) U.S. nonprofit organization created to provide a unique space where veterans, active-duty military, first responders, educators, caregivers, and their families can experience healing through nature. What began as a simple vision—to offer a sanctuary for peace, recovery, and camaraderie—has grown into a mission-driven organization rooted in the belief that the natural world can restore both the mind and spirit. Based in Maine, River’s Bend Trout–Sebec serves participants through outdoor programs and experiences in the Sebec and Dover-Foxcroft area. Our founder, RJ Horwitz, is an avid fly fisher whose personal journey reflects both service and healing. He recognized the powerful impact nature can have on mental and emotional well-being. Through therapeutic outdoor programs—including mindfulness practices, fly fishing and nature-based activities—RBT-S fosters belonging, resilience, and connection. Participants are given opportunities not only to heal individually but also to grow together and strengthen their family connections. River’s Bend Trout–Sebec continues to expand its reach and deepen its impact. Every step forward stands as a testament to the strength, courage, and renewal of those we serve. We remain dedicated to creating a peaceful, supportive environment that nurtures the body, mind, and soul.
